Lasik laser eye surgery in jalandhar at our centre is a type of eye surgery that uses lasers to correct vision problems, specifically those caused by refractive errors. A refractive error is where your eye fails to bend light properly, distorting your vision. It can cause, for example, blurry vision, nearsightedness and farsightedness.

WHAT ARE LASIK LASER EYE SURGERY TYPES
LASIK (Laser-Assisted-In-Situ Keratomileusis) is currently one of the most frequently performed procedures in the world. It is a highly effective outpatient procedure, often referred to as refractive surgery, and is used to correct myopia and hyperopia, as well as astigmatism. This procedure, which is performed by ophthalmologist’s and trained LASIK surgeons, uses a cool beam of light from the excimer laser to gently reshape the front surface (cornea) of your eye. This is done by creating a corneal flap on the surface of the eye, which is peeled back to allow the excimer laser begin reshaping
LASIK stands for LASER Assisted in situ Keratomielusis. Lasik Laser vision Correction is performed using the excimer Laser,a computer controlled “cool” ultraviolet beam of light. the laser sculpts the cornea into a shape that allows light focus more directly on the retina, which eliminates or reduces a variety of eye abnormalities.

SmartSurfACE TECHNOLOGY
The innovative SmartSurfACE eye lasering procedure is impressive and touch-free. It combines the advantages of SCHWIND’s proven TransPRK surface ablation method and revolutionary SmartPulse technology. The result is clear vision without compromise.
Unlike with previous methods, the eye is not touched with any instrument. Instead, the SCHWIND AMARIS laser corrects vision through the top layers of the cornea, without suction, flap, or incision, and without the use of alcohol. SmartSurfACE is non-invasive, safe, gentle, and stress-free for the patient.
SmartPulse technology gives the cornea a very smooth surface. This results in optimum vision quality in the early post-operative phase and significantly faster healing.

2.CORNEAL WAVEFRONT [SCHWIND SIRIUS PLUS LATEST MODEL]
This is used to to take 3D computerised maps of cornea so as to measure symptomatic aberrations of the cornea.




The combination of a sophisticated 3D Scheimpflug camera and well-established Placido topography provides highly precise information about the entire anterior segment of the eye. All biometric measurements allow up to 100 corneal pachymetry sections for each acquisition.
Benefits at a glance
Precise information on pachymetry, elevation, curvature and dioptric power, each in relation to the anterior and posterior corneal surfaceDiagnosis of the entire anterior segment of the eye in one step
High image quality over a corneal diameter of 16 millimetres
Calculation of all biometric measurements for the anterior segment of the eye with up to 100 high-resolution corneal pachymetry sections. The user can select the number of sections per measurement.
More precise centring and results through static cyclotorsion correction information for treatment with SCHWIND AMARIS
Its very high resolution of one micrometer detects even the slightest irregularities.
- The measuring process does not require any medical pupil dilation.
- Automatic repeatability tests assist the selection of appropriate images for treatment planning.
- Deep-set eyes as well as small eyes can easily be measured.
- The corneal wavefront analysis documents the type and size of all optical errors existing on the anterior corneal surface and allows a high-precision diagnosis.
- It also provides all key topographical information needed to enhance IOL power calculation and IOL selection.
- Pupil diameter can be measured under both scotopic and photopic lighting conditions with the aid of the integrated pupillometry function.
3. SCHWIND OCULAR WAVEFRONT ANALYZER (Imagine Eyes)
The Ocular Wavefront Analyzer is the latest generation of multi-functional aberrometres. It analyses the optical characteristics of the whole eye in a single measuring process.

- A high-resolution Hartmann-Shack sensor for the analysis of wavefront aberration
- Excellent resolution of 230 µm, 1024 measuring points.
- Expanded dynamic range of -15/+20 D sphere and +/- 10 D astigmatism
- Precise and objective measurement of the patient’s accommodative response.
- Integrated pupillometry: Detection of the scotopic pupil size (in mm) under dark room conditions.
- Implemented keratometry function measuring the corneal curvature
- Extensive software package offers many analysis options – whether in tabular form, as bar diagram or as wavefront map.

AM I A CANDIDATE FOR LASIK LASER EYE SURGERY IN JALANDHAR ?
Check your Lasik eligibility if You Are a Candidate for LASIK Eye Surgery
Patients planning lasik laser eye surgery
- Should be 18 years of age or older, and should have a prescription which has been stable for 18 months. There is no upper age limit for the procedure.
- Should have healthy corneas.
- Women should not be pregnant or within eight weeks of either pregnancy or nursing.
- Patients with active rheumatoid arthritis or lupus should not have LASIK.
- Some patients with uncontrolled diabetes should not have the surgery, but those with good blood sugar control and without diabetic eye disease may still have surgery.
- Patients with very thin corneas may not be candidates for LASIK, but may be eligible for LASEK or epi-LASIK. A comprehensive topographic assessment using the Pentacam Scheimpflug Imaging System helps to determine the corneal thickness and eligibility.

FAQ’s [frequently asked questions] in lasik laser eye surgery]
What type of anesthetic is used for Lasik laser eye surgery?
The procedure is done with topical anesthetic (eye drops) to numb the eye. Patients may be given a small amount of oral sedative to help them relax.
Does the lasik laser eye surgery procedure hurt?
Patients are given a topical anesthetic (eye drops) to numb the eye, so they experience no pain. When the surgeon applies the vacuum ring, the patient experiences a sensation of pressure just before his or her vision fades for a few seconds. The microkeratome – the instrument the surgeon uses to create the flap – and the laser do not cause any pain or discomfort.

For several hours after the procedure, many patients describe a mild burning sensation, such as after opening the eyes while swimming in chlorinated water. After the first few hours, this uncomfortable feeling usually subsides.
How long will the lasik laser eye surgery procedure take?
The whole procedure takes about 10 to 15 minutes for two eyes, including creating the flap and performing the laser under the flap.
Are the results achieved from lasik laser eye surgery permanent?
The effects of lasik eye surgery are permanent. The effects of lasik laser surgery do not wear off. But it is important to realize that a person’s eye can still change internally. That is why many surgeons recommend having the procedure done after the major eye changes have occurred in one’s life.
For instance, lasik laser surgery is not recommended on children because their eyes change a great deal. They would need the vision fine-tuned in a few years. If the procedure is performed after the age of 18, the chance of long-term stable correction is more likely. Even the eyes of patients over the age of 18 can still be changing.
Therefore, we recommend a good conversation with your surgeon so they can review the changes you have had and help you make a decision whether or not you should wait until the changes have slowed down.
Patients should also note that while results are usually stable, they can be modified by enhancement procedures – procedures performed after the initial one – if necessary.
How long will it take before I can see well, and how long will it take before I have my best vision?

Discomfort is rare and minimal. Usually vision is immediately improved but may fluctuate for some days.The eyes and lids cannot be rubbed to protect the flap for few days. Drops are used forfour weeks.usualy best of vision is achieved within 7 to 10 days.
Can I have both eyes done with lasik surgery at the same time?
You can have bilateral simultaneous LASIK (both eyes done at the same time).
If I have lasik laser eye surgery and my vision changes later in life, can it be redone?
Re-treatment may be a viable solution to vision changes later in life and other treatment options may exist, such as Intacs. You would need to see your ophthalmologist to determine the cause of the change and which option may be best for you.
